To qualify for residency in Hungary as a skilled artisan, applicants must meet specific criteria that demonstrate their expertise and contribution to the local economy. Firstly, artisans must possess formal qualifications or certifications in their trade, verifying their skills through recognized institutions. Additionally, a portfolio showcasing previous work is essential, illustrating the quality and creativity of their craft.

Documentation must include proof of employment or a business plan if self-employed, highlighting the sustainability of their work in Hungary. Applicants are also required to provide evidence of financial stability, such as bank statements or income declarations, to ensure they can support themselves during their residency. Furthermore, a clean criminal record and health insurance coverage are mandatory, ensuring that artisans contribute positively to the community. This comprehensive documentation not only aids in the evaluation process but also underscores the artisan's commitment to integrating into Hungarian society.

Craftsmanship in Győr has deep historical roots, tracing back to medieval times when artisans played a crucial role in the city's development. This tradition not only fostered a unique cultural identity but also significantly contributed to the local economy. Skilled artisans, from potters to blacksmiths, established workshops that became the backbone of trade, attracting merchants and boosting commerce. Today, this legacy continues, with modern artisans blending traditional techniques with innovative practices, enhancing Győr's reputation as a hub for high-quality craftsmanship. Applying for residency in Hungary as a skilled artisan involves several key steps. First, gather the necessary documentation, including proof of your craft skills, a valid passport, and a clean criminal record. Next, complete the residency application form, ensuring all information is accurate to avoid delays.

Once submitted, be prepared for potential challenges such as language barriers or bureaucratic hurdles. It’s advisable to seek assistance from local artisan groups or legal advisors familiar with Hungarian immigration laws. They can provide valuable insights and support throughout the process.

After your application is submitted, monitor its status regularly and be ready to provide additional information if requested by the authorities. Patience is crucial, as processing times can vary. By following these steps and being proactive about challenges, artisans can successfully navigate the residency application process in Hungary.
